What to Know About Goubonne

Key Facts

Goubonne is a settlement or locality within the Tibesti Ouest department of the Tibesti Region in northern Chad. Located in the remote and mountainous Tibesti Massif, Goubonne sits in the western portion of this vast desert region, which forms part of the larger Sahara Desert. As a specific locality within Tibesti Ouest, it represents one of the populated points in this sparsely inhabited area, with the broader Tibesti Region having an estimated population of only around 20,000-30,000 people spread across approximately 100,000 square kilometers of rugged volcanic terrain. The Tibesti Ouest department itself contains multiple settlements like Goubonne, though exact administrative subdivisions at this local level can be fluid. This area is known for its extreme isolation, dramatic landscapes featuring extinct volcanoes and deep canyons, and a climate characterized by scorching daytime temperatures and significant temperature drops at night.
